[Movie] Pearls of the Far East - Ngoc Vien Dong

The inner lives and forbidden loves of seven Vietnamese women form the beautiful string that runs through director Cuong Ngo's feature film debut, Pearls of the Far East. Adapted from award-winning stories by Minh Ngoc Nguyen, Ngo weaves a vivid, timeless and unforgettable tapestry with characters brought to life by a gorgeous cast of acclaimed talent from Vietnam, US and Canada, including actresses Truong Ngoc Anh (The White Silk Dress, 2006), Nhu Quynh (Vertical Ray of the Sun, 2000), Hong Anh (Moon at the Bottom of the Well, 2009), Ngo Thanh Van (The Clash, 2010, The Rebel, 2007), Minh Ngoc Nguyen (who also wrote the screenplay based on her own stories), and the legendary Kieu Chinh (Joy Luck Club, 1993). Áo Lụa Hà Đông – The White Silk Dress

North American Premiere Winner of the Audience Award at the Pusan International Film Festival, The White Silk Dress is a magnificent drama that portrays how one poor and oppressed family manages to maintain its pride and dignity and to overcome adversities. Hoi An, Vietnam in the 1950s. Dau and Gu, who have slaved away for a landlord all their lives, finally are able start a family. However, they get caught within the unrelenting cycle of war and poverty and face numerous tragedies. Even after losing everything, they still maintain their faith in the Ao Dai-a symbol of the lofty and pure willpower of Vietnamese women-that Dau has left behind. Set against a background of the deep-rooted traditional culture, Huynh Luu's beautiful film not only captures the story of a family, the sacrifice of a mother or one couple's passionate love story, but also illustrates the spirit of a country and of a nation determined to keep their traditions alive. Saigon Eclipse - Nhật Thực

" The Curse of Beauty and the Cost of Loyalty" English Title: Saigon Eclipse Vietnamse Title: Nhật Thực " Kieu a beautiful and talented actress, is starring in a film directed by Kim , an American/Vietnamese who has come back to Vietnam to become a part of the new wave of Vietnamese film culture. The film is being produced by her Uncle Henry and her mother Ba Tu . It is a seemingly wonderful situation until the fragile family balance is disrupted when Kieu falls in love with her director, and Uncle Henry's mounting gambling debts shut down production of the film. Uncle Henry embraces dishonest ways to pay off his debts entering the murky realm of human trafficking. Kieu must come to terms with the curse of beauty and the cost of loyalty that has forever burdened her life. Can Kieu save her family?
